


Link11 and AWS Shield compete in the cyber threat protection category. Link11 shows agility with custom solutions, while AWS Shield offers superior integration and threat detection, giving it an upper hand.
Features: Link11 is recognized for its user-friendly dashboard, custom solutions, and strong agility in adapting to customer needs. It also excels in supporting modifications and optimizing security architecture using Reblaze. AWS Shield effectively defends against DDoS attacks, offers seamless integration features, and utilizes pattern recognition for threat detection. It provides real-time attack visibility and 24/7 access to a DDoS response team.
Room for Improvement: Link11 could enhance its change management process and improve reporting alerts. Requests also exist for better session and bot management. AWS Shield faces criticism for its expensive pricing model and lacks comprehensive features in the Standard tier. Users desire improvements in anomaly detection speed and logging capabilities, as well as enhanced dashboard features.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Link11 supports Hybrid, Private, and Public Clouds and provides strong customer service with high responsiveness. AWS Shield is limited to Public Cloud deployments but offers excellent technical support, although asynchronous communication may be limited by geographical constraints. Both services are praised for effective deployment processes and responsive customer support.
Pricing and ROI: Link11 offers flexible and predictable pricing with discounts and trial periods, making it appealing with comprehensive coverage. AWS Shield's pricing scales with subscription levels and AWS spending, affecting cost-effectiveness. While competitive, expenses for advanced protection impact its value. Both offer strong ROI through effective service availability, despite different pricing dynamics.

AWS Shield offers robust DDoS protection with seamless integration into AWS services, providing users with enhanced security without impacting performance. Its intuitive dashboard and integration with tools like WAF and CloudWatch make it a go-to for many organizations seeking reliable protection.
AWS Shield provides real-time attack visibility and transparency, excelling in DDoS protection while maintaining application and network layer security. The Advanced tier offers automated threat detection, tailored defense strategies, and a responsive DDoS team. However, challenges include high costs, limited customization, and a need for better traffic insights. Organizations must often rely on additional AWS services for comprehensive network security. The solution is primarily used to protect against DDoS attacks and secure web applications, offering Layer 3 and 4 security. While the Standard tier offers basic security at no cost, the Advanced tier provides enhanced protection against severe attacks such as SYN floods, albeit with a monthly fee.

Link11, headquartered in Germany, offers cloud-based IT security services designed to prevent business disruptions, enhancing cyber resilience for IT networks and critical applications globally. Their services benefit industries across Europe, North America, and Asia with comprehensive protection.
Link11 provides a range of security and performance solutions, including Network Security, Web Application & API Protection, and Application Performance solutions. Their offerings encompass Network DDoS protection and an all-in-one WAAP solution, featuring Web Application Firewall, Web DDoS Protection, Bot Management, API Protection, and Secure CDN & DNS. A high-performance global network, monitored 24/7 by the Link11 Security Operations Center, ensures robust defense mechanisms.
